Session Là Gì? Cơ Chế Hoạt Động của Session

08/04/2024 09:39 PM    |    Tìm việc   >  Công nghệ thông tin

Trong lĩnh vực công nghệ thông tin, session là một thuật ngữ phổ biến nhưng cũng gây hiểu lầm cho nhiều người. Vậy session là gì? Trong bài viết này, chúng ta sẽ đi sâu vào khám phá khái niệm này, cùng tìm hiểu về ý nghĩa và ứng dụng của session trong thế giới công nghệ hiện đại.

Xem thêm: Khóa Chính là gì Trong Cơ Sở Dữ Liệu

 Session là Gì?

Session là một khái niệm dùng để chỉ một kết nối tạm thời giữa một người dùng và một hệ thống hoặc dịch vụ trực tuyến. Trong suốt quá trình sử dụng một ứng dụng web, trình duyệt hoặc ứng dụng di động, mỗi lần bạn truy cập vào một trang web hoặc kích hoạt một chức năng cụ thể, một session mới sẽ được tạo ra.

session là gì

Ý Nghĩa của Session

Session có ý nghĩa quan trọng trong việc duy trì trạng thái và tương tác giữa người dùng và hệ thống. Một session được bắt đầu khi người dùng truy cập vào một trang web hoặc dịch vụ nào đó và kết thúc khi người dùng đăng xuất hoặc thoát khỏi ứng dụng.

Trong suốt quá trình session diễn ra, thông tin như dữ liệu người dùng, tùy chọn, và các hoạt động của họ được lưu trữ và duy trì.

Khám phá thông tin tuyển dụng IT mới nhất hiện nay

Cơ Chế Hoạt Động của Session

Cơ chế hoạt động của session thường được xây dựng dựa trên các công nghệ như cookies, tokens, hoặc session ID. Khi người dùng truy cập vào một trang web, một session ID sẽ được tạo ra và gắn liền với phiên làm việc của họ.

Thông qua session ID này, hệ thống có thể nhận diện và theo dõi hoạt động của người dùng trong suốt thời gian họ duy trì phiên làm việc.

Ứng Dụng của Session Trong Công Nghệ

Session được sử dụng rộng rãi trong nhiều lĩnh vực công nghệ, bao gồm:

  • Ứng Dụng Web: Session được sử dụng để duy trì trạng thái của người dùng, như thông tin đăng nhập, giỏ hàng, và cài đặt cá nhân.
  • Ứng Dụng Di Động: Session giúp duy trì liên kết giữa người dùng và ứng dụng, cho phép họ trải nghiệm liên tục mà không cần phải đăng nhập lại sau mỗi lần khởi động lại ứng dụng.
  • Bảo Mật: Đóng vai trò quan trọng trong việc bảo mật thông tin của người dùng, giúp ngăn chặn các cuộc tấn công như session hijacking và session fixation.

Mobile developer là gì – khám phá con đường trở thành mobile developer nhanh nhất

session là gì

Trên đây là một cái nhìn tổng quan về khái niệm “session” trong lĩnh vực công nghệ thông tin. Session không chỉ đơn giản là một kết nối tạm thời giữa người dùng và hệ thống, mà còn là cơ sở quan trọng để duy trì trạng thái và tương tác trong quá trình sử dụng ứng dụng web và di động. Hiểu rõ về session giúp người phát triển ứng dụng thiết kế và triển khai hệ thống một cách hiệu quả, đồng thời cung cấp trải nghiệm người dùng tốt nhất có thể.

Truy cập website tìm việc làm uy tín, chất lượng để không bỏ lỡ cơ hội hấp dẫn nào
Tags:

Bài viết liên quan

OPC là gì? Ứng Dụng Của OPC Trong Công nghệ thông tin

OPC là gì? Ứng Dụng Của OPC Trong Công nghệ thông tin

Trong lĩnh vực công nghiệp, OPC là một thuật ngữ phổ biến nhưng có thể gây hiểu nhầm đối với...

Hosting Server là gì? 4 Loại Hình Hosting Server Phổ Biến

Hosting Server là gì? 4 Loại Hình Hosting Server Phổ Biến

Hosting server, một thuật ngữ thường được nghe trong lĩnh vực công nghệ thông tin và phát triển web. Trong...

Unix là gì? Các Đặc Điểm Nổi Bật Của Hệ Điều Hành Unix

Unix là gì? Các Đặc Điểm Nổi Bật Của Hệ Điều Hành Unix

Unix là một trong những hệ điều hành phổ biến và mạnh mẽ nhất được sử dụng trên các máy...

Bài đọc nhiều

3D Animation là gì? Công việc của một Animator 3D là làm gì?

3D Animation là gì? Công việc của một Animator 3D là làm gì?

Trước đây, các 2D Animator đòi hỏi cần khả năng vẽ tốt, khả năng tạo hình ảnh hoàn hảo nối…

Multimedia là gì?Phân biệt Multimedia và Graphic Design

Multimedia là gì?Phân biệt Multimedia và Graphic Design

Multimedia là ngành học hiện đang được các bạn trẻ yêu thích và theo học. thực tế cho thấy đây là ngành nghề  mới đang còn khá…

Data Scientist là gì? Công việc của Data Scientist là làm gì?

Data Scientist là gì? Công việc của Data Scientist là làm gì?

Nếu như muốn phát triển sự nghiệp trong lĩnh vực công nghệ, chắc hẳn bạn đã từng nghe nói đến…

Bài mới nhất

Virtual Machine là gì: Ý Nghĩa và Ứng Dụng Trong Công Nghệ

Virtual Machine là gì: Ý Nghĩa và Ứng Dụng Trong Công Nghệ

Virtual Machine (VM) là một khái niệm quan trọng trong lĩnh vực công nghệ thông tin, đặc biệt là trong…

Computer Programmer Là Gì? Tất Cả Những Gì Bạn Cần Biết

Computer Programmer Là Gì? Tất Cả Những Gì Bạn Cần Biết

Bạn đã từng nghe đến “computer programmer” nhưng không biết chính xác nó là gì? Trong bài viết này, chúng…

OPC là gì? Ứng Dụng Của OPC Trong Công nghệ thông tin

OPC là gì? Ứng Dụng Của OPC Trong Công nghệ thông tin

Trong lĩnh vực công nghiệp, OPC là một thuật ngữ phổ biến nhưng có thể gây hiểu nhầm đối với…

Theo dõi chúng tôi

Chúng tôi thích chia sẻ những ưu đãi mới và các chương trình

Đăng ký nhận tin

Nhận bài viết qua email cùng HR Insider - Timviec.